Ambassadors’ visit to the Károlyi-Csekonics Palace

Upon the invitation of Dr. habil. Ágnes Czine, Acting Rector, the Ambassadors of Spain, Lebanon, India and Japan visited the Károlyi-Csekonics Palace on 2nd July 2021.

Following the greetings of the Rector and the Dean, Their Excellencies Ms Anunciada Fernández de Córdova, Ms Joanna Azzi, Mr Kumar Tuhin and Mr Masato Otaka were introduced to the history and international relations of the University and the Faculty of Humanities and Social Sciences. During the meeting, the Ambassadors presented the current economic and educational trends and challenges of their countries. The aim of the meeting was for the University to widen the opportunities for educational and scientific cooperation with institutions of higher education in the four countries. At the end of the program, the members of the delegation visited the Károlyi-Csekonics Palace.

 

The aim of the Károli Gáspár University of the Reformed Church in Hungary is to continue to strengthen its excellent academic relations and research activities with the countries represented by the embassies.
